ROSENSTEEL, Richard W.


The Arizona Republic, Phoenix, Arizona Friday, July 25, 2003 Richard W. Rosensteel, 84, of Sedona, AZ, passed away July 19, 2003. He was born in Elder's Ridge, PA. He was a WWII veteran and retired operating engineer. He spent much of his life operating heavy equipment while building the roads of America. In his later years he enjoyed traveling these roads and pointing out the places he had worked. He also enjoyed lapidary and working in his garden. Richard was preceded in death by his sisters Charlotte, Mary, Alma and brothers Clarence, David and Carl, and the mother of his children, Beatrice. He is survived by his loving wife Jeannette, son Richard of Greensburg, PA, daughter Edwina of Mesa, AZ, 12 grandchildren and 16 great-grand-children.
